I quite liked the look of it too - my only reservation is the buggy bit is only suitable from 3 months (info on the manufacturer's site - the shop I linked to got it wrong).

A newborn would be fine in the car seat bit but only for short trips - a Techno type stroller that lies properly flat, and a carseat for in-car-only use would be my preference.
